Abstract:
Method of systematically simulating and displaying the cyclical components of the behaviour of the movement of a curve relating two parameters to one another, in which the following are obtained: a moving average (14) of the curve (10); an oscillator (16), a series of dynamic moving averages (20,22,24,26,28); and pairs of inner and outer envelopes (32,34; 35,37; 36,38). This derived information is used as a basis to calculate the probable future movement of the curve (10). An industrial application of this method controls the flow of coolant liquid through a chamber (102). A temperature sensor (108) supplies information to a computer (106) which is in communication with the use through a keyboard (114) and control unit (112). Set of lines relating to the above derived information are displayed on a V.D.U. (116), from which the user can either manually effect control of the rate of flow of the coolant liquid via a pump (104) or request the computer to automatically effect the control to prevent the temperature of the coolant liquid exceeding or falling below given limits.
